Sustainable Fashion in UAE

The United Arab Emirates, a hub of global commerce and innovation, is increasingly recognizing the importance of sustainable practices across various industries, including fashion. While the region is known for its luxurious and fast-paced lifestyle, a growing awareness of environmental and social responsibility is driving a shift towards more sustainable fashion choices. This transition is particularly evident in the growing popularity of eco-friendly t-shirts, a wardrobe staple that can be produced and consumed more responsibly.


One of the key drivers of sustainable fashion in the UAE is the increasing awareness among consumers about the environmental impact of fast fashion. Initiatives promoting conscious consumption, such as local markets featuring sustainable brands and educational campaigns highlighting the benefits of eco-friendly materials, are gaining traction. For t-shirts, this means a growing demand for organic cotton, recycled fabrics, and ethically produced garments. Local designers and brands are responding by incorporating these materials into their collections and adopting more sustainable manufacturing processes.


The UAE's commitment to sustainability extends beyond consumer awareness. Government initiatives and regulations are encouraging businesses to adopt environmentally friendly practices, including in the textile industry. For example, efforts to reduce waste and promote recycling are creating opportunities for the use of recycled materials in t-shirt production. Furthermore, the development of sustainable infrastructure, such as solar-powered manufacturing facilities, is supporting the growth of eco-conscious businesses.


The unique climate of the UAE also plays a role in the adoption of sustainable t-shirts. The hot and humid weather necessitates breathable and comfortable clothing, making organic cotton and other natural fibers ideal choices. These materials not only provide comfort but also reduce the reliance on synthetic fabrics, which contribute to pollution and microplastic shedding. Local initiatives are also boosting the sustainable fashion scene. Many local designers are focused on creating unique, high-quality t-shirts that reflect both regional culture and modern design principles. This includes using traditional patterns and motifs on sustainably produced t-shirts, creating a fusion of heritage and eco-consciousness. Pop-up markets and online platforms are providing spaces for these designers to showcase their work, fostering a community of sustainable fashion enthusiasts.


Looking ahead, the sustainable t-shirt market in the UAE is poised for continued growth. As consumers become more educated and environmentally conscious, they will increasingly seek out eco-friendly options. Brands that prioritize sustainability, transparency, and ethical practices will be well-positioned to thrive in this evolving market. The UAE’s dedication to innovation and sustainability suggests that it will become a leading example of how to blend modern fashion with responsible practices, even in the realm of everyday items like the simple t-shirt.
